Tartu Airport in a nutshell

The smallest of Estonia's two international airports is located 10 km south of the university city of Tartu in the south of the country.
The vast majority of international flights to Estonia go via the main Tallinn airport, and only Finnair currently flies to Tartu twice a day from Helsinki, where it connects with other flights around the world.
Tartu Airport uses one very small terminal. The check-in process takes about 10 minutes, so you only need to arrive at the airport 40-45 minutes before your flight.
